Key Topics Covered in a Comprehensive Course

A top-tier Web Application Penetration Testing Course delves into a wide array of subjects essential for effective security assessments. These topics are structured to provide a holistic understanding of web application security.

Understanding Web Technologies

Before diving into attacks, a good Web Application Penetration Testing Course establishes a strong foundation in web technologies. This includes HTTP/HTTPS, web servers, databases, and various client-side and server-side scripting languages.

A deep understanding of these underlying components is crucial for identifying potential attack surfaces.

OWASP Top 10 Deep Dive

The OWASP Top 10 list of critical web application security risks is a cornerstone of any quality Web Application Penetration Testing Course. This section covers common vulnerabilities in detail.

Participants learn how to identify and exploit issues like Injection, Broken Authentication, Sensitive Data Exposure, XML External Entities (XXE), and Broken Access Control.

Authentication and Authorization Bypass

Many attacks target the authentication and authorization mechanisms of web applications. A dedicated Web Application Penetration Testing Course teaches techniques to bypass these controls.

This includes brute-forcing, session hijacking, insecure direct object references, and privilege escalation methods.

Client-Side Attacks

Client-side vulnerabilities can have significant impacts on users. A comprehensive Web Application Penetration Testing Course covers attacks such as Cross-Site Scripting (XSS), Cross-Site Request Forgery (CSRF), and DOM-based vulnerabilities.

Understanding these attacks is vital for protecting user data and maintaining application integrity.

Server-Side Attacks

Server-side vulnerabilities often lead to the most severe breaches. Topics in a Web Application Penetration Testing Course include SQL Injection, Command Injection, Server-Side Request Forgery (SSRF), and insecure deserialization.

These sections equip learners with the ability to compromise backend systems and extract sensitive information.

API Penetration Testing

With the rise of microservices and mobile applications, API security has become critical. A modern Web Application Penetration Testing Course includes modules on testing REST and SOAP APIs for common vulnerabilities.

This ensures comprehensive coverage of all web-facing components.

Reporting and Remediation

Identifying vulnerabilities is only half the battle. A crucial part of a Web Application Penetration Testing Course is learning how to document findings effectively. This includes writing clear, concise reports.

Furthermore, the course emphasizes recommending practical and actionable remediation strategies to fix identified security flaws.

Practical Skills You’ll Gain

A hands-on approach is fundamental to any effective Web Application Penetration Testing Course. Participants gain practical experience through labs and real-world simulations.

Hands-on Labs and Tools

The best courses incorporate extensive lab exercises using industry-standard tools like Burp Suite, OWASP ZAP, Nmap, and various command-line utilities. This practical exposure solidifies theoretical knowledge.

Learners apply techniques directly, gaining confidence in their ability to perform actual penetration tests.

Real-world Scenarios

Simulating real-world attack scenarios helps participants understand the complexities of web application security. A quality Web Application Penetration Testing Course often includes capture-the-flag (CTF) challenges or simulated environments.

These scenarios prepare individuals for the challenges they will face in professional penetration testing roles.
